Prohibited Activities
You may not use Contactwho to:
- Scrape or bulk-extract data — automated scraping, crawling, or systematic downloading of contact or company data beyond normal use of the Service is prohibited.
- Resell or redistribute data — contact data obtained through Contactwho is for your own business use only. You may not resell, sublicence, or redistribute it to third parties.
- Send spam or unsolicited bulk messages — using contact data to send unsolicited commercial messages in violation of applicable anti-spam laws (including CAN-SPAM, GDPR, and PECR) is prohibited.
- Circumvent usage limits — creating multiple accounts, using automation to bypass credit limits, or exploiting technical vulnerabilities to obtain additional credits or access is prohibited.
- Impersonate others — misrepresenting your identity or affiliation when using the Service or contacting individuals through data obtained from Contactwho.
- Engage in unlawful activity — using the Service for any purpose that violates applicable local, national, or international law.
- Harass or harm — using contact data to stalk, harass, threaten, or otherwise harm any individual.
- Interfere with the Service — introducing malware, attempting to gain unauthorised access, or taking actions that disrupt or degrade the Service for other users.
- Claim ownership of third-party data — representing that contact or company data obtained through Contactwho is your proprietary data, or using it in a manner that implies endorsement, affiliation, or a business relationship with the companies or individuals described in the data.
Data Protection Compliance
You are responsible for ensuring your use of contact data complies with all applicable data protection and privacy laws, including the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) and the California Consumer Privacy Act (CCPA). This includes having a lawful basis for processing personal data, honouring data subject rights, and maintaining appropriate records of your processing activities.
You acknowledge that contact data provided through the Service originates from licensed third-party sources and may be subject to additional legal restrictions in certain jurisdictions. You are solely responsible for verifying the lawfulness of your intended use of this data, including but not limited to outreach, marketing, and recruitment activities.
Consequences of Violation
Violation of this AUP may result in one or more of the following actions, at Contactwho's sole discretion:
- A written warning and request to cease the prohibited activity.
- Temporary suspension of your account and access to the Service.
- Permanent termination of your account without refund.
- Reporting to relevant law enforcement or regulatory authorities.
- Legal action to recover damages.
